Ireland is known for the Ring of Kerry and Wild Atlantic Way, making it a great fit for dramatic coastal road trips. Here's what to know about driving there, and how to prepare your documents before you go.
Traffic in Ireland moves on the left-hand side, so it's worth reading our left-hand driving guide before you pick up a rental car, especially at roundabouts and unmarked intersections.
Rental agencies and local authorities in Ireland commonly ask for your passport, your original driver's license, and an International Driving Permit translation document at pickup or during a roadside check. Carrying all three together helps avoid delays — see our full documents checklist.
